Transaction 458ed321c090e87055d8cea2bfc511fcff8ae2adb0664dcb2ea01df8b0ae1aa3
1 Input
2 Outputs
- 458ed321c090e87055d8cea2bfc511fcff8ae2adb0664dcb2ea01df8b0ae1aa3:0
- 458ed321c090e87055d8cea2bfc511fcff8ae2adb0664dcb2ea01df8b0ae1aa3:1
value 7137616
address 1Ng51SXK4fbBdE29934UdMJPgCz9693R74
value 630580914
address 18h5oHLXLb6RTugFyVcKNo26vz8ZvusnET